So, how do we make this cohesive look a reality? The secret lies in selecting a family of finishes from a commercial-grade furniture line. Manufacturers understand this need for harmony. Popular choices include powder-coated aluminum in timeless hues like matte black, forest green, or earth brown, which offers exceptional durability and color consistency across all product types. Another excellent option is thermally modified wood paired with matching metal accents, providing natural warmth with unified metal tones. Even concrete finishes can be specified to have similar aggregate exposures or stain colors.
The benefits extend far beyond mere appearance. A coordinated set reduces visual clutter, making spaces feel larger and more serene. It strengthens your campus's brand identity, signaling attention to detail. From a practical standpoint, sourcing from the same collection often simplifies maintenance and future purchasing.
